Product reviews:
Horace
2025-08-14 iphone 7
Matthew Fitzpatrick wins Omega European 2018 omega european masters
2018 omega european masters
Ronald
2025-08-07 iphone XS Max
European Tour Fantasy Golf Predictions 2018 omega european masters
2018 omega european masters
2018 Omega European Masters 2018 omega european masters
2018 omega european masters